Transaction 27a13b052486909af1a73581d00d2daac91f66933a34ba1619f6a4775684bed9

1 Input
2 Outputs
  • 27a13b052486909af1a73581d00d2daac91f66933a34ba1619f6a4775684bed9:0
  • value  12413
    address  3HpPnPK7H9jpHwjsUX6AM4Hqb6y8q2J9gv
  • 27a13b052486909af1a73581d00d2daac91f66933a34ba1619f6a4775684bed9:1
  • value  605222
    address  138eE4U12itEpzZcnbtrpohn7J9NdgtSRx